在網絡編程中,一般都是多線程的編程,這就出現了一個問題:數據的同步與共享。而互斥鎖和條件變量就是為了允許在線程或進程間共享數據、同步的兩種最基本的組成部分。它們總能夠用來同步一個進程中的多個線程。再進入互斥鎖和條件變量之前,我們先對多線程的一些相關函
命令 -選項 參數如果選項是一個單詞時,選項前面要加2個-modprobe -r pcspkr 在終端中輸入的時候有聲音,可以用這個命令屏蔽聲音 ,需要root權限ls 顯示目錄下的內容,和Windows下的dir命令相當ls -l(L的小寫)
Linux中的命令的確是非常多,但是我們只需要掌握我們最常用的命令就可以了。當然你也可以在使用時去找一下man,他會幫你解決不少的問題。然而每個人玩Linux的目的都不同,所以他們常用的命令也就差異非常大。因為不想在使用是總是東查西找,所以在此總
來由不得不說在windows下下載自從有了迅雷以後就沒有考慮過什麼是BT還是電驢下載,總之只要有什麼thunder,有magnet,或者是ed2k的統統丟進迅雷,歐,當然還有.torrent的種子,迅雷都可以一站式解決,加上校園網的下載速度不差,
快速安裝可視化IDS系統 (帶視頻)本節為大家介紹的軟件叫安全洋蔥Security Onion,根OSSIM一樣,它是基於DebianLinux的系統,內部集成了很多開源安全工具,NIDS、HIDS、各種監控工具等等,下面我們就一起體會一下它如何
前一天學習了 at 命令是針對僅運行一次的任務,循環運行的例行性計劃任務,linux系統則是由 cron (crond) 這個系統服務來控制的。Linux 系統上面原本就有非常多的計劃性工作,因此這個系統服務是默認啟動的。另外, 由於使用者自己也可以
fileclear.shtamcdir=${HOME}/ora/user_projects/domains/tamccd ${tamcdir}echo rm -f `ls heapdump*.phd`rm -f heapdump*.phdecho r
(1) 配置jdk安裝環境需要jdk1.7_79以下的jdk版本,以上的不兼容。我以前本地的是jdk1.7_80 ,編譯好後,放到tomcat下不行。jdk環境安裝的過程如下:1:獲得jdk1.7.67>wget --no-check-cert
前言現在很多朋友都了解或者已經在使用LNMP架構,一般可以理解為Linux Shell為CentOS/RadHat/Fedora/Debian/Ubuntu/等平台安裝LNMP(Nginx/MySQL/PHP),LNMPA(Nginx/
之前我們整理了互斥鎖與條件變量問題它保證了共享資源的安全,但在多線程中我們也會經常對共享數據進行讀、寫操作。也就是說對某些資源的訪問會 存在兩種可能的情況,一種是訪問必須是排查性的,就是獨占的意思,這稱作寫操作;另一種情況就是訪問方式可以是共享的
1. 安裝SVNapt-get install subversion2. 建立svn倉庫 1). 建立svn目錄:mkdir /home/.svn(使用隱藏目錄) 2). cd /home/.svn 3). mkdir astar 4).
在之前的學習中我們的服務端同一時間只能為一個客戶端提供服務,即使是將accept()函數包含在循環中,也只能是為多個客戶端依次提供服務,並沒有並發服務的能力,這顯然是不合理的。通過多進程的使用,我們可以很便捷的實現服務端的多進程,這樣就可以同時為多個
玩過Linux的人都會知道,Linux中的命令的確是非常多,但是玩過Linux的人也從來不會因為Linux的命令如此之多而煩惱,因為我們只需要掌握我們最常用的命令就可以了。當然你也可以在使用時去找一下man,他會幫你解決不少的問題。然而每個人玩L
如果某項請求發送到您的服務器要求顯示您網站上的某個網頁(例如,用戶通過浏覽器訪問您的網頁或 Googlebot 抓取網頁時),服務器將會返回 HTTP 狀態代碼以響應請求。此狀態代碼提供關於請求狀態的信息, 告訴 Googlebot 關於您的網站
puppet是一種Linux、Unix、windows平台的集中配置管理系統,使用自有的puppet描述語言,可管理配置文件、用戶、cron任務、軟件包、系統服務等。puppet把這些系統實體稱之為資源,puppet的設計目標是簡化對這些資源的管
創建組接口nmcli con add con-name team0 ifname team0 type team config '{"runner":{"name":"activebackup
總線干嘛的?說白了就是用來傳輸數據的,在計算機的各個部件之間。比如我主存裡存的數據CPU要用,需要一條線路傳過去吧,CPU內部各個寄存器之間、寄存器與ALU、CU與各個部件之間等等等等很多地方,總之就是部件之間需要傳輸數據 傳輸的數據分為三種,對
我們經常在Linux下可以看到inode,都不知道是什麼東東,那麼我們現在來慢慢了解下。 一、inode是什麼? 理解inode,要從文件儲存說起。 文件儲存在硬盤上,硬盤的最小存儲單位叫做"扇區"(Sector)。
最近用Linux在玩Tomcat,啟動的時候總是會報錯(8080/8009/8005),於是整理了一下網上零亂的查看PID和端口的命令,以備記錄。 1.由端口號查詢PID號 首先myeclipse報錯的時候會提示:“8009端